It’s time for another post with my super duper cute stamps by Tammy Tutterow Designs. I’m using the stamp ‘Joy to the World‘. I wanted to focus on shadows on this post because I get so many emails about where to add shadows. If you know my coloring you will see I actually left this image very flat. I didn’t add very much definition into the the world, heart or the star. But what really makes this image pop is the fact that I defined just around the the green ornament, on the 2 ornaments behind it. This little bit of definition behind the green ornament makes a huge difference and really makes it seem like the green one is in front of them.

A few weeks ago I did a blog post on STOP trying to find the Light Source — you have to color in a way that just makes sense.

Copic Marker List:

  • BG10, BG11. BG13, BG15
  • E44, E43, E42
  • G20, G21, G24, G85
  • C6 – for Shadows
  • R35, R37, R39,
